OSRS Fletching Yew Longbow Ultimate Guide

Fletching yew longbows in Old School RuneScape (OSRS) is a profitable and efficient way to train the Fletching skill while earning gold pieces (GP). At level 70 Fletching, players unlock the ability to craft yew longbows, which offer a balance of decent experience rates and solid profit margins. Yew longbows are a popular choice for players because they strike a balance between affordability, experience gains, and profitability. Unlike lower-tier bows like oak or willow, yew longbows provide higher XP per action and can be sold for a profit on the Grand Exchange (GE) or high-alched for additional Magic XP. Here’s why they’re worth your time:
- Profit Potential: Fletching unstrung yew longbows can yield up to 300k–500k GP per hour, depending on GE prices.
- XP Rates: You can achieve up to 127,500 Fletching XP per hour by fletching unstrung bows or 183,750 XP per hour by stringing them.
- Accessibility: Only level 70 Fletching is required, making it achievable for mid-level players.
- Flexibility: Choose between fletching unstrung bows for AFK training or stringing for higher XP and profit.
Requirements for Fletching Yew Longbows
Skill Level
You need at least level 70 Fletching to craft yew longbows. If you’re not there yet, consider fletching maple longbows (level 55) or willow longbows (level 40) to bridge the gap.
Items Needed
To fletch yew longbows, you’ll need the following items:
- Yew logs: Purchase from the Grand Exchange or cut them yourself with 60 Woodcutting.
- Knife: Available from the GE, general stores, or monster drops.
- Bow strings: Required for stringing unstrung yew longbows; buy from the GE or craft via flax spinning.
- Optional: Nature runes for High Alchemy if you plan to alch the bows.
Recommended Stats and Quests
While not mandatory, these can enhance your fletching experience:
- 60 Woodcutting: To cut yew logs yourself, saving GP.
- 50 Magic: For High Alchemy to convert bows into GP and gain Magic XP.
- Kandarin Hard Diary: Completing this diary includes a task to create a yew longbow from scratch in Seers’ Village, offering additional rewards.
How to Fletch Yew Longbows Step-by-Step
Method 1: Fletching Unstrung Yew Longbows
Fletching unstrung yew longbows is the most AFK-friendly method, ideal for players who want to multitask or minimize clicks. Here’s how it works:
- Purchase yew logs from the Grand Exchange (approximately 249–281 GP each, depending on market prices).
- Equip a knife or have it in your inventory.
- Use the knife on the yew logs to open the fletching interface.
- Select the “Yew Longbow (u)” option to craft unstrung bows.
- Sell the unstrung bows on the GE (around 397 GP each) or high-alch them for 384 GP each.
XP and Profit: This method yields 75 Fletching XP per log and up to 1,500 bows per hour, equating to 112,500 XP/hour. Profit can reach 300k–500k GP/hour based on GE prices.
Method 2: Stringing Yew Longbows
Stringing yew longbows is more click-intensive but offers higher XP and profit. Follow these steps:
- Buy yew longbows (u) and bow strings from the GE (bow strings cost around 70 GP each).
- Use the unstrung yew longbows on the bow strings to create completed yew longbows.
- Sell the finished bows on the GE (approximately 506 GP each) or high-alch for 768 GP each.
XP and Profit: Stringing provides 75 XP per bow, and with up to 2,400 bows per hour, you can achieve 180,000 XP/hour. Profits range from 250k–331k GP/hour, with high-alching potentially adding 80k Magic XP/hour.
Combining Both Methods
For maximum XP, you can fletch and string yew longbows from scratch:
- Cut or buy yew logs and use a knife to craft unstrung yew longbows (75 XP per log).
- String the unstrung bows with bow strings (additional 75 XP per bow).
- Sell or alch the finished yew longbows.
XP and Profit: This method grants 150 XP per log. With efficient banking, you can process around 1,200 logs per hour, yielding 180,000 XP/hour and profits up to 264k GP per log when sold on the GE.
Profit and XP Comparison Table
Here’s a breakdown of the two main methods for fletching yew longbows, based on approximate GE prices as of May 2025:
Method | XP per Hour | GP per Hour | Click Intensity | High Alchemy Option |
---|---|---|---|---|
Fletching Unstrung Yew Longbows | 112,500 | 300k–500k | Low (AFK) | 384 GP per bow (65k Magic XP/hour) |
Stringing Yew Longbows | 180,000 | 250k–331k | High | 768 GP per bow (80k Magic XP/hour) |
Combined (Fletch + String) | 180,000 | 264k | Moderate | 768 GP per bow (80k Magic XP/hour) |
Note: Prices fluctuate, so check the Grand Exchange for real-time data before investing.
Tips to Maximize Efficiency and Profits
Optimize Your Setup
To fletch faster and earn more, consider these strategies:
- Bank at the Grand Exchange: Train at the GE for quick access to materials and instant selling.
- Use Mouse Keys: For stringing, mouse keys can reduce click strain and speed up the process.
- Stock Up: Buy yew logs and bow strings in bulk to avoid GE buy limits and price spikes.
High Alchemy vs. Selling
Deciding whether to sell or alch depends on your goals:
- Selling on GE: Usually more profitable due to market demand, especially for unstrung bows.
- High Alchemy: Offers Magic XP (up to 65k–80k per hour) but may result in a slight loss if nature runes are bought (e.g., 217 GP each). Check alch prices vs. GE prices before committing.
Ironman Considerations
For Ironman accounts, fletching yew longbows is still viable but requires more prep:
- Woodcutting: Cut yew logs at locations like Varrock, Catherby, or the Woodcutting Guild (level 60 Woodcutting required).
- Bow Strings: Gather flax from places like Seers’ Village and spin it into bow strings using a spinning wheel (e.g., Lumbridge Castle).
- High Alchemy: Use yew longbows for alching to fund other skills, as Ironmen can’t rely on GE sales.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Maximize your gains by steering clear of these pitfalls:
- Ignoring GE Prices: Always check live prices for yew logs, unstrung bows, and bow strings before starting. Price fluctuations can turn a profit into a loss.
- Overbuying Supplies: Test methods with small batches (e.g., 100 logs) to confirm profitability before committing millions of GP.
- Stringing Low-Tier Bows: Avoid stringing bows below yew level (e.g., willow or maple) as they often result in losses.
- Neglecting Banking Time: XP rates assume minimal banking. Use a bank close to your fletching spot to maintain efficiency.
